Additional Tips for Battery Optimization
Beyond choosing the right band, other practices can help maximize your Garmin Epix Gen 2’s battery life. These include managing screen brightness, disabling unnecessary notifications, and updating firmware for optimal performance.
Sensor and Display Settings
- Reduce screen brightness
- Use power-saving mode during extended activities
- Limit the use of GPS and heart rate sensors when not needed
